Hey how does that ECU get a load signal? The crank pickup only gives RPM information.
 
I visited the Gotech Site and they have a 1UZ powered tow truck that puts out 98KW (at the wheels I hope).

This would be a little more than two thirds of what I would have expected from a stock ECU.

Where is the benefit in all the cost and work. Leave it standard and get more power.
 
Thats what I was thinking. I can't see how fuel mixtures could be anywhere near correct if there is no load input to determine how much fuel needs to be injected.
